Full Job Description
Job Description

Project Management protects Guardian Mortgage executives, employees, and customers by ensuring that GMC strategic, operational and information technology initiatives are prioritized based on corporate goals, receive the necessary amount of subject matter expert attention, achieve the minimum amount of risk and are deployed in a timely manner.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

1.Project Management - Prepare and manage strategic, operational and IT project plans in a timely, accurate and compliant manner. Effectively manage project manager reports, monitor and report status through project completion to senior and executive management. With assistance from senior and executive management, identify subject matter experts in each department, solicit their commitment and buy-in to each initiative and project. Resolve any issues and solve problems throughout project life cycle.

2.Compliance - Safeguard company assets by ensuring operational procedure and information technology systems of GMC and significant business partners comply with company policy/procedures, contracts, investor guidelines, lending programs and state and federal law and regulation.

3.Vendor Management - Assess vendors and any IT systems necessary for all projects and initiatives to ensure they meet GMC risk and compliance standards. Oversee vendor projects, managing task plans through to implementation. Ensure software deliveries are met. Facilitate weekly "in touch" calls with vendors as needed to deploy the projects in a timely manner.

4.Information Technology - Display high level knowledge of the IT risk management/information security industry and practices related to mortgage lending, as well as relevant areas of information technology. Supporting role in trouble shooting GMC IT system issues. Advocate role for system users with vendors.

5.Priority Management - Effectively prioritize, re-priorities and terminate unsuccessful strategic initiatives and projects as necessary to meet corporate objectives and goals.

6.Developmental Improvement - Develop tools, best practices, processes and procedures for more effective initiative management and implementation.

7.Leadership - Lead, coach, and motivate project managers and other team members on a proactive basis. Encourage continuous improvement and professional growth for the development of each team member.

8.Judgment - Display an independent ability to calculate and evaluate risk, make timely decisions, and exercise sound judgment.

9.Deadlines - Consistently hit ongoing deadlines as prioritized with senior and executive management.

10.Compliance - Meet rules, obligations, timelines, and deadlines to comply with company policy, contracts, investor guidelines, lending programs, and state/federal law and regulation.
